标题:高效自动字幕生成工具——Autosub,一键实现视频字幕自动化
autosub项目地址:https://gitcode.com/gh_mirrors/aut/autosub
项目介绍
Autosub是一款强大的自动化字幕生成软件。它通过Auditok自动检测语音区域,利用ffmpeg进行音频分割,并依赖于多种API进行语音转文本和翻译任务,如Google Speech V2、Google Cloud Speech-to-Text以及百度语音识别。其最新版本仅在Alpha分支中提供,功能更加强大且稳定。
技术分析
Autosub基于Python开发,充分利用了各种开源库的特性:
- Auditok:用于智能地检测视频中的对话区域。
- ffmpeg和ffprobe:处理音频文件的分割和元数据提取。
- pysubs2:生成高质量的字幕文件格式。
- Speech-to-Text APIs:包括谷歌和百度的语音识别服务,提升识别准确度。
- py-googletrans:用于快速文本翻译,支持多语言。
此外,还使用了langcodes
来识别和处理语言代码,以及python-Levenshtein
和fuzzywuzzy
进行字符串相似度计算。
应用场景
Autosub适用于以下场景:
- 多媒体编辑:为视频添加精准的字幕,提高观看体验。
- 教育领域:自动生成课程或讲座的字幕,方便学习者理解。
- 字幕翻译:快捷地将外语视频转化为母语字幕,扩大观众群体。
- 无障碍服务:帮助听障人士理解有声内容。
项目特点
- 自动检测:准确捕捉视频中的语音部分,无需手动调整。
- 多平台兼容:支持Ubuntu及Windows系统,有独立可执行文件供Windows用户直接使用。
- 多API支持:可以选择不同的语音识别和翻译服务,适应不同需求。
- 灵活配置:支持预处理音频、自定义API参数,满足个性化需求。
- 高效处理:通过优化的工作流程,大大提升了字幕生成效率。
如果您需要一个便捷、高效的自动化字幕解决方案,Autosub无疑是您的理想选择。无论是个人创作还是专业团队,都能从这款强大工具中受益。现在就下载并试用Autosub,让您的视频内容更具互动性和包容性吧!